    public String getDvPortGroupName(VirtualEthernetCard nic) throws Exception {
        VirtualEthernetCardDistributedVirtualPortBackingInfo dvpBackingInfo =
                (VirtualEthernetCardDistributedVirtualPortBackingInfo) nic.getBacking();
        DistributedVirtualSwitchPortConnection dvsPort = dvpBackingInfo.getPort();
        String dvPortGroupKey = dvsPort.getPortgroupKey();
        ManagedObjectReference dvPortGroupMor = new ManagedObjectReference();
        dvPortGroupMor.setValue(dvPortGroupKey);
        dvPortGroupMor.setType("DistributedVirtualPortgroup");
        return (String) _context.getVimClient().getDynamicProperty(dvPortGroupMor, "name");
    }

    public VirtualEthernetCardDistributedVirtualPortBackingInfo getDvPortBackingInfo(Pair<ManagedObjectReference, String> networkInfo)
            throws Exception {
        assert (networkInfo != null);
        assert (networkInfo.first() != null && networkInfo.first().getType().equalsIgnoreCase("DistributedVirtualPortgroup"));
        final VirtualEthernetCardDistributedVirtualPortBackingInfo dvPortBacking = new VirtualEthernetCardDistributedVirtualPortBackingInfo();
        final DistributedVirtualSwitchPortConnection dvPortConnection = new DistributedVirtualSwitchPortConnection();
        ManagedObjectReference dvsMor = getDvSwitchMor(networkInfo.first());
        String dvSwitchUuid = getDvSwitchUuid(dvsMor);
        dvPortConnection.setSwitchUuid(dvSwitchUuid);
        dvPortConnection.setPortgroupKey(networkInfo.first().getValue());
        dvPortBacking.setPort(dvPortConnection);
        System.out.println("Plugging NIC device into network " + networkInfo.second() + " backed by dvSwitch: "
                + dvSwitchUuid);
        return dvPortBacking;
    }
